1. Comprehending Part Categories: OEM vs. Aftermarket
When acquiring parts for a Dodge Ram, the very first decision an owner should make is whether to purchase Original Equipment Manufacturer (OEM) parts or aftermarket options.
O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er)
OEM parts are produced by the very same producer that developed the initial elements for the car (Mopar, when it comes to Ram). These parts are developed to fulfill the specific specs of the truck.
Pros: Perfect fitment, ensured compatibility, and frequently backed by a dealer warranty.Cons: Generally more expensive than third-party alternatives.Aftermarket Parts
Aftermarket parts are produced by companies besides the initial maker. These range from high-performance upgrades to economical replacements.
Pros: Frequently more economical; some efficiency brand names really surpass OEM standards (e.g., Bilstein shocks or K&N filters).Cons: Quality differs substantially between brands; some parts may need modifications to fit correctly.2. Typical Maintenance Parts for Dodge Ram Trucks

Tips for Identifying the Correct Part
To prevent the frustration of getting a part that does not fit, purchasers need to follow a methodical technique to identification.
Locate the VIN (Vehicle Identification Number): The VIN is the most precise way to discover parts. It identifies the engine type, drivetrain, and trim level.Verify the Part Number: If the old part is available, the Mopar part number is normally marked on it. Cross-referencing this number ensures an exact match.Inspect the Build Date: Manufacturers often change parts mid-year. Understanding the month and year of manufacture (found on the motorist's door jamb) can be critical.Consider the Generation:2nd Gen (1994-2002): Focus on steering and rust repair.3rd Gen (2002-2009): Focus on engine sensors and interior parts.4th Gen (2009-2018): Focus on air suspension and electronic devices.5th Gen (2019-Present): Focus on modern sensing units and infotainment.6.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: Can I utilize RAM 1500 parts on a RAM 2500?A: Generally, no. While they may look similar, the 2500 and 3500 series make use of various frames, durable suspensions, bigger brakes, and various axle setups compared to the light-duty 1500.

Q: Will installing aftermarket parts void my warranty?A: According to the Magnuson-Moss Warranty Act, a dealership can not void a guarantee even if an aftermarket part was utilized. Nevertheless, if the aftermarket part triggers a failure in another part, that particular repair might not be covered.

Q: Why are Mopar parts more expensive?A: Mopar parts are the main parts of the manufacturer. They undergo rigorous testing to ensure they meet federal security and emissions standards, which contributes to the production cost.

Q: How do I know if a part is a "authentic" Dodge Ram part?A: Genuine parts will usually can be found in Mopar-branded packaging and feature a holographic sticker or a specific 8-to-10-digit part number followed by 2 letters (e.g., 12345678AB).

Q: Where is the very best location to discover discontinued parts for older Dodge Ram 1500 Truck Part USA Rams?A: For trucks older than 20 years, specialized remediation websites and automobile recyclers (salvage lawns) are the best resources, as Mopar might no longer produce those particular products.
